  • Radeon 520 has 150% more power consumption, than HD Graphics 4400.
  • HD Graphics 4400 is connected by PCIe 1.0 x16, and Radeon 520 uses PCIe 3.0 x8 interface.
  • Both cards are used in Laptops.
  • HD Graphics 4400 is build with Gen. 7.5 Haswell architecture, and Radeon 520 - with GCN 1.0.
  • Core clock speed of Radeon 520 is 830 MHz higher, than HD Graphics 4400.
  • HD Graphics 4400 is manufactured by 22 nm process technology, and Radeon 520 - by 28 nm process technology.
